Is the Mag tube replaceable?

I just picked up a 500a for $175 but the mag tube looks like someone took a hammer to it. Is the mag tube replaceable? If it is, can I replace it, or does a gunsmith need to replace it? Can I use a 7 round or will it have to be a 5 round? I think Buba was working on it.

Yes it is replaceable. Do you know how old the gun is? If not post the first few letters and numbers of the serial number.
To use a 7 round tube you will need to change the barrel also.
You will need to use some heat on the receiver where the tube threads into the receiver, (Mossberg uses LocTite).
Keep us posted.
 
Remove the barrel then apply heat on the receiver around the tube on all sides with a heat gun. Be patient and heat both sides for a couple minutes. Then use a rubber strap wrench on the tube 2"-3" from the receiver so it doesn't get scorched--the tube should unscrew right out. Clean any old Loctite from the threads in the receiver. The replacement tube should screw right in and use the strap wrench to snug it in. Many people do not re-apply Loctite when installing the tube but inspect it to make sure it is not unscrewing when at the range. I'll put a drop of Loctite blue on the threads which usually does the trick for me...

I would recommend you repair your mag tube at this stage of the game as 500 parts are on the scarce side and demand a premium. A metal shop may be able to internally swage/expand it round again so it functions properly. PPS: you will still have to get it out without destroying it.

You might be able to find just a tube and that would be the least expensive solution if you can't straighten your old one. You can re-use the spring and follower if you can get them out. There are short and long tubes. Short works with with 18", 24", 28" etc barrels. Long (7rd) works with the 20" barrel (only). There are some oddball longer barrels for the long tube that come up once in a while but are very rare.
